
The School of Public Health (SPH), founded in 1999 as a result of grassroots efforts of community leaders and public health officials, is now one of the only 48 accredited schools in North America. SPH has grown rapidly in student enrollment and research funding since its initial accreditation with the Council on Education for Public Health (CEPH) in June 2002, while maintaining strong and vital links with public health professionals in the community. In 2007, SPH was re-accredited for the maximum term of seven years.
In addition to the master of public health (MPH) and doctor of public health (DrPH) degrees, master of health administration (MHA) degree and now offers the Doctor of Philosophy in Public Health Sciences (PhD) degree. SPH offers dual degree programs with the Texas College of Osteopathic Medicine, the University of North Texas Anthropology Department and the University of Texas at Arlington School of Nursing.
